                            Stop deleting your comments so I can explain overpay to you.


                            Item overpay is generally 10%.

                            We subtract the 10% by multiplying by 0.9 (if we multiply it by 1 its 100%, multiply by .95 is 95% etc.)

                            Example:

                            I'm selling a hat for 50 keys

                            I get a 55 key offer (in items)

                            The price of the hat I sold won't go up to 55 keys.

                            To price my hat we would do 55*0.9=49.5 (round to 50)
